net.sf.emarket.trade.repository
Interface IOrderMatchDao

All Superinterfaces:
java.io.Serializable
All Known Implementing Classes:
JdbcOrderMatchDaoImpl

public interface IOrderMatchDao
extends java.io.Serializable


Method Summary
 void addOrderMatch(OrderMatch match)
           
 long generateOrderFillId()
           
 long generateOrderMatchId()
           
 OrderMatch getOrderMatch(long matchId)
           
 java.util.List<OrderMatch> getOrderMatchesForBuyOrder(java.lang.String buyOrderId)
           
 java.util.List<OrderMatch> getOrderMatchesForSellOrder(java.lang.String sellOrderId)
           
 

Method Detail

addOrderMatch

void addOrderMatch(OrderMatch match)

getOrderMatch

OrderMatch getOrderMatch(long matchId)

generateOrderMatchId

long generateOrderMatchId()

generateOrderFillId

long generateOrderFillId()

getOrderMatchesForBuyOrder

java.util.List<OrderMatch> getOrderMatchesForBuyOrder(java.lang.String buyOrderId)

getOrderMatchesForSellOrder

java.util.List<OrderMatch> getOrderMatchesForSellOrder(java.lang.String sellOrderId)


Copyright © 2009. All Rights Reserved.